HDMI 2.0 Extender over Fiber

Model: 4KEX300-F

Introduction

Overview

This product is a slim HDMI transmitter receiver set. It supports resolutions up to 4K@60Hz 4:4:4 8bit and HDCP 2.2, transporting HDMI signals up to 300m/1000ft over a duplex OM3 multi-mode optical fiber cable. The kit supports bi-directional IR/RS232 pass through via DIP Switch settings, enabling users to control the source or display devices at either the transmitter or receiver side with ease. The transmitter and receiver are easy to install, space-saving, and offer ideal solutions for homes, offices, digital entertainment centers, control centers, conference rooms, schools, and corporate training environments.

Panel Description

Front Panel (Transmitter/Receiver)

The front panel of the Transmitter/Receiver unit features indicator LEDs and the AV Access logo.

No. Name Description
1 Power LED On: The device is powered on. Off: The device is powered off.
2 Status LED Blinking: The device is working properly. Off: The device is not working properly.
3 HDCP LED On: HDCP protected content is being transmitted. Blinking: Non-HDCP protected content is being transmitted. Off: No content is being transmitted.
4 Link LED On: The link between transmitter and receiver is normal. Blinking: The link between transmitter and receiver is abnormal. Off: No link.

Rear Panel - Transmitter

The rear panel of the Transmitter unit includes the following ports:

No. Name Description
1 DC 12V Connect to the DC 12V power adapter provided.
2 HDMI In Connect to HDMI source such as a Blu-ray player.
3 Optical Out Connect to the Optical In port of the receiver via a duplex OM3 multimode optical fiber cable.
4 RS232 For RS232 pass through.
5 IR In Connect to the supplied IR receiver with adhesive.
6 IR Out Connect to the supplied IR emitter. Secure the IR emitter on the IR receiving sensor of the source device with adhesive.
7 Switch Switch to RS232 or IR mode. RS232: For RS232 pass through. IR: For IR pass through.

Rear Panel - Receiver

The rear panel of the Receiver unit includes the following ports:

No. Name Description
1 DC 12V Connect to the DC 12V power adapter provided.
2 HDMI Out Connect to an HDMI display device.
3 Optical In Connect to the Optical Out port of the transmitter via a duplex OM3 multi-mode optical fiber cable.
4 RS232 For RS232 pass through.
5 IR In Connect to the supplied IR receiver with adhesive.
6 IR Out Connect to the supplied IR emitter. Secure the IR emitter on the IR receiving sensor of the source device with adhesive.
7 Switch Switch to RS232 or IR mode. RS232: For RS232 pass through. IR: For IR pass through.

Installation

Note: Ensure the fiber cable length is within 300m/1000ft.

Connection Steps:

  1. Connect the HDMI source (e.g., DVD player) to the Transmitter's HDMI In port.
  2. Connect the Transmitter and Receiver using a duplex OM3 fiber optic cable via their respective Optical Out and Optical In ports.
  3. Connect the HDMI display (e.g., TV) to the Receiver's HDMI Out port.
  4. Connect the IR Receiver to the Receiver's IR In port.
  5. Set the Switch on the Receiver to the desired mode (RS232 or IR).
  6. Connect the IR emitter to the Transmitter's IR Out port.
  7. Connect the DC 12V power adapters to both the Transmitter and Receiver.

Diagram Description: The installation diagram illustrates connecting a DVD player (HDMI source) to the Transmitter's HDMI In. The Transmitter and Receiver are linked by a duplex OM3 fiber optic cable. A TV (HDMI display) connects to the Receiver's HDMI Out. An IR emitter connects to the Transmitter's IR Out, and an IR receiver connects to the Receiver's IR In. Power supplies are connected to both units. Switches on both devices are shown set to 'IR mode'.

RS232 Pass Through

The RS232 ports provide a channel to pass through protocol commands to control third-party devices such as your source or display. To enable this, switch the panel DIP Switch to RS232 mode on both the transmitter and receiver. Then, connect RS232-enabled devices (e.g., a computer and a projector) to the respective RS232 ports using RS232 cables. Please refer to the following pin definition of RS232 during your installation.

RS232 Port Connected RS232 Device Pins
GND GND
RX TX
TX RX

Diagram Description: The RS232 Pass Through diagram shows a PC connected via HDMI to the Transmitter's HDMI In. An RS232 cable connects the PC to the Transmitter's RS232 port (switch set to RS232 mode). A duplex OM3 fiber optic cable links the Transmitter's Optical Out to the Receiver's Optical In. A projector connects to the Receiver's HDMI Out, and its RS232 port is connected to the Receiver's RS232 port via an RS232 cable (switch set to RS232 mode).

Specification

Technical Details
Video Signal Type HDMI 2.0, HDCP2.2
Input/Output Resolution Supported 800x600, 1024x768 (60Hz), 1280x768 (60Hz), 1280x800 (60Hz), 1280x960 (60Hz), 1280x1024 (60Hz), 1360x768 (60Hz), 1366x768 (60Hz), 1440x900 (60Hz), 1600x900 (60Hz), 1600x1200 (60Hz), 1680x1050 (60Hz), 1920x1080 (60Hz), 1920x1200 (60Hz), 3840x2160P (24Hz, 25Hz, 30Hz, 50Hz, 60Hz), 4096x2160P (24Hz, 25Hz, 30Hz, 50Hz, 60Hz).
Audio Format Stereo, PCM2.0/5.1/7.1, Dolby TrueHD and DTS HD Master Audio
Fiber Type Duplex Multi-mode 850nm OM3 Fiber
Fiber Connector Type LC to LC
Maximum Data Rate 18Gbps
General Details
Operation Temperature 0°C to 45°C (32°F to 113°F)
Storage Temperature -20°C to 70°C (-4°F to 158°F)
Humidity 10% to 90% (non-condensing)
ESD Protection ± 8kV (Air-gap discharge) / ± 4kV (Contact discharge)
Surge Protection Voltage: ±1 kV
Power Consumption (Max) Transmitter: 3.9W, Receiver: 3.5W
Device Size (W x H x D) 150 mm x 20 mm x 74.4 mm (5.91"x 0.79"x 2.93")
Product Weight Transmitter: 0.30kg / 0.66lb, Receiver: 0.30kg / 0.66lb
Transmission Distance Range Supported Video
Optical Fiber 300m/1000ft 4K@60Hz 4:4:4 8bit
Input/Output: 15m/50ft 1080P@60Hz
Input/Output: 10m/33ft 4K@30Hz
Input/Output: 3m/10ft, Input/Output: 5m/16ft 4K@60Hz 4:4:4 8bit
